Cricketer Sugeni Kananji Biography - Cricket Profile
- Full Name: Sugeni Kananji
- Birth Date: 01 Aug, 2005
- Age:
- Batting Style: Right hand Bat
- Bowling Style: Right arm Medium fast
- Teams:
Advertisement
Batting & Fielding Average
Type | Mat | Inns | NO | Runs | HS | BF | SR | 100 | 50 | 4s | 6s | Ct | St |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
WT20Is | 9 | 8 | 1 | 96 | 42 | 120 | 80.00 | 0 | 0 | 11 | 0 | 5 | 0 |
Bowling Average
Type | Mat | Inns | Balls | Runs | Wkts | BBI | BBM | Ave | Econ | SR | 4w | 5w | 10 |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
WT20Is | 9 | 8 | 105 | 112 | 7 | 2/6 | 2/6 | 16.00 | 6.40 | 15.0 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
